Job description
Principal Engineer - Water Infrastructure

UK-Wide | Hybrid Working

Contract (Minimum 12 Months)

Water Sector | Infrastructure & Environmental Projects

A respected engineering consultancy is seeking a Principal Engineer to join its expanding water infrastructure team. This is a senior technical leadership role for a Chartered Engineer (or equivalent) with expertise in network modelling, hydraulics, and feasibility design. The position offers hybrid working from offices across the UK, with opportunities to contribute to high-impact water and wastewater projects that support sustainable development and community resilience.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ead the design and delivery of water and wastewater infrastructure projects.
  • Conduct network modelling and hydraulic analysis to support planning and design.
  • Ensure engineering solutions meet technical, regulatory, and client standards.
  • Provide technical leadership and mentor junior engineers.
  • Support client engagement and project coordination.
Ideal Candidate
  • Chartered Engineer status or equivalent experience.
  • Strong technical background in water infrastructure, especially network modelling and hydraulics.
  • Experience in feasibility and concept design; detailed design is a plus.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Collaborative and proactive approach to engineering delivery.
